Jacy is 4 Months Old!

It is hard to believe that Jacy is going to be 4 months old tomorrow! She actually had her 4-month check-up with her Dr. On Wednesday. She is 9lbs. 12 oz. and 21 inches long. She is a very sweet baby and we are having so much fun with her! She is now smiling at us, and has even given us some out loud giggles when we play peek-a-boo with her. They melt our hearts!!! The Pediatrician is happy with her weight gain, but is concerned about her head. The measurement of her head circumference has increased 5 centimeters in the past month, which is more than normal. The head becoming enlarged is one of the signs that the ventricles are becoming enlarged with fluid and putting pressure on the brain. We have been scheduled for another brain MRI next Wednesday July 27th. We don't know what the outcome will be, but we are preparing ourselves mentally for the possibility of her needing shunts.
